Chicago study links more urban tree cover to fewer deaths

{}A new study by Northwestern University has found that neighbourhoods in Chicago that lost more tree canopy over 11 years also recorded higher mortality rates, particularly in hotter areas. The researchers say protecting mature trees, along with planting new ones, could help reduce heat-related health risks and improve public health in cities.
